[PATCH 2/7] ipt_SYSRQ compile fix for 2.6.21

Fixes compilation of ipt_SYSRQ.

Signed-off-by: Jan Engelhardt <jengelh@xxxxxx>

Index: linux-2.6.21-rc5/net/ipv4/netfilter/ipt_SYSRQ.c
===================================================================
--- linux-2.6.21-rc5.orig/net/ipv4/netfilter/ipt_SYSRQ.c
+++ linux-2.6.21-rc5/net/ipv4/netfilter/ipt_SYSRQ.c
@@ -9,10 +9,9 @@
 
 #include <linux/netfilter_ipv4/ip_tables.h>
 
-#include "rsysrq.h"
-
-#include "sha1.c"
-#include "rsysrq_protocol.c"
+#include "ipt_sysrq_g.h"
+#include "ipt_sysrq_sha1.c"
+#include "ipt_sysrq_protocol.c"
 
 static char *passwd = "";
 module_param(passwd,charp,0);
@@ -38,12 +37,7 @@ static int target_do( char *buf, int len
 	if( (c=rsysrq_extract((struct rsysrq_s*)buf,passwd,now.tv_sec,tolerance))==0 )
 		return(0);
 	
-#if LINUX_VERSION_CODE < KERNEL_VERSION(2,6,0)
-	handle_sysrq(c, NULL, NULL, NULL );
-#else
-	handle_sysrq(c, NULL, NULL );
-#endif
-	
+	handle_sysrq(c, NULL);
 	return(1);
 }
 
@@ -64,8 +58,7 @@ target(struct sk_buff **pskb,
 #if LINUX_VERSION_CODE >= KERNEL_VERSION(2,6,17)
        const struct xt_target *target,
 #endif
-       const void *targinfo,
-       void *userinfo)
+       const void *targinfo)
 #endif
 {
 	const struct iphdr *iph = (*pskb)->nh.iph;
@@ -101,14 +94,14 @@ checkentry(const char *tablename,
 	   const struct ipt_entry *e,
 #endif
            void *targinfo,
-           unsigned int targinfosize,
            unsigned int hook_mask)
 {
 	return 1;
 }
 
-static struct ipt_target ipt_sysrq_reg = {
+static struct xt_target ipt_sysrq_reg = {
         .name           = "SYSRQ",
+        .family		= AF_INET,
         .target         = target,
         .checkentry     = checkentry,
         .me             = THIS_MODULE,
@@ -120,7 +113,7 @@ static struct ipt_target ipt_sysrq_reg =
 
 static int __init init(void)
 {
-	if (ipt_register_target(&ipt_sysrq_reg))
+	if (xt_register_target(&ipt_sysrq_reg))
 		return -EINVAL;
 
 	return 0;
@@ -128,7 +121,7 @@ static int __init init(void)
 
 static void __exit fini(void)
 {
-	ipt_unregister_target(&ipt_sysrq_reg);
+	xt_unregister_target(&ipt_sysrq_reg);
 }
 
 module_init(init);
